Comparison of Different Types of Agency Project Management Software
Agency project management software is available in various deployment models,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Cloud-based solutions offer accessibility, scalability, and automatic updates, eliminating the need for on-site infrastructure. On-premise solutions provide greater control over data security and customization but require dedicated IT resources and maintenance. Hybrid models combine aspects of both, offering flexibility and control. The choice depends on the agency’s size, budget, technical capabilities, and data security requirements. Smaller agencies might find cloud-based solutions more cost-effective, while larger agencies with stringent security needs might prefer on-premise or hybrid solutions.

Project Tracking and Collaboration
Effective project tracking and collaboration are cornerstones of successful agency operations. Real-time visibility into project progress, task assignments, and deadlines is crucial for maintaining momentum and identifying potential roadblocks early. Features such as Kanban boards, Gantt charts, and customizable workflows provide diverse perspectives on project status. Seamless communication tools, including integrated chat functions and file sharing, foster efficient teamwork and reduce reliance on external platforms. Furthermore, robust notification systems ensure all stakeholders are kept informed of critical updates and changes.
Resource Management and Capacity Planning
Efficient resource management and accurate capacity planning are critical for maximizing team productivity and preventing overallocation. The software should provide a clear overview of team member availability, skills, and current workload. This allows for strategic assignment of tasks, preventing burnout and ensuring timely project completion. Automated features, such as workload forecasting and resource allocation suggestions, can significantly improve efficiency and reduce the risk of scheduling conflicts. For example, a feature could analyze upcoming projects and automatically suggest the best-suited team members based on their skill sets and availability.
Integrated Time Tracking and Billing
Streamlining agency operations requires integrated time tracking and billing capabilities. Accurate time tracking ensures accurate invoicing and prevents disputes with clients. Software should allow team members to easily log their work hours against specific projects and tasks. This data should then be automatically used to generate invoices, reducing manual effort and improving accuracy. Real-time reporting on billable hours and project profitability provides valuable insights into agency performance and helps identify areas for improvement. Consider a scenario where a project manager can generate a client invoice with a single click, automatically pulling data from tracked time entries.
Client Communication and Portal Features
Maintaining strong client relationships is vital for agency success. Dedicated client portals provide a centralized hub for communication, document sharing, and project updates. Clients can access real-time project progress, submit feedback, and approve deliverables within the portal, eliminating the need for constant email exchanges. Features such as secure file sharing, progress dashboards tailored for clients, and integrated communication tools (e.g., direct messaging) significantly enhance client satisfaction and transparency. For instance, a client can log in to view a customized dashboard showing the current status of their projects, including timelines and milestones.

Common Challenges in Agency Project Management Software Implementation
Agencies frequently encounter resistance to adopting new project management software. This resistance stems from various sources, including concerns about the time investment required for training, potential disruption to existing workflows, and skepticism regarding the software’s actual value. Furthermore, integrating the new software with pre-existing systems and data can prove complex and time-consuming, especially in larger agencies with established processes. Data migration issues, lack of proper training, and insufficient support from the software vendor also contribute to a challenging implementation. Finally, selecting the right software that meets the agency’s specific needs and integrates seamlessly with its existing infrastructure can be a significant undertaking in itself.
Strategies for Overcoming Resistance to Change and Ensuring User Adoption
Successful software adoption hinges on effective change management. This involves a multi-pronged approach, starting with clear communication of the software’s benefits and how it will improve individual workflows. Agencies should emphasize the positive impact on efficiency, collaboration, and ultimately, profitability. Comprehensive training programs, tailored to different user roles and skill levels, are essential. Providing ongoing support and readily available resources, such as FAQs and video tutorials, further mitigates user frustration and encourages adoption. Early and consistent feedback mechanisms allow for addressing concerns and making necessary adjustments to the implementation plan. Finally, showcasing success stories and highlighting early wins can significantly boost morale and encourage broader buy-in.
Best Practices for Integrating Project Management Software with Existing Agency Workflows
Successful integration requires careful planning and execution. Before implementation, agencies should thoroughly analyze their existing workflows to identify potential points of friction and areas where the software can offer improvements. A phased rollout approach, starting with a pilot program in a specific team or department, can minimize disruption and allow for iterative adjustments. Data migration should be carefully planned and executed to ensure data integrity and minimize downtime. Furthermore, robust APIs and integrations with existing tools, such as CRM and accounting software, are essential for seamless data flow and eliminating redundant data entry. Continuous monitoring and optimization of the integrated system are vital to ensure its long-term effectiveness.

Impact of Emerging Technologies
Blockchain technology offers the potential for enhanced security and transparency in project management. Imagine a system where all project documents and milestones are immutably recorded on a blockchain, providing an auditable trail and reducing the risk of disputes. Extended reality (XR), encompassing vir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R), can revolutionize collaboration and training. VR could be used to simulate project environments, allowing teams to collaboratively review designs or walkthrough complex processes before implementation. AR overlays could provide real-time project information directly onto physical workspaces, enhancing efficiency and reducing errors. For instance, an AR application could superimpose a 3D model of a website design onto a physical mockup, allowing the team to visualize the final product and make necessary adjustments in real-time.

Typical Costs of Agency Project Management Software
The cost of agency project management software varies considerably depending on several factors. Pricing models typically include subscription-based plans with tiered features and pricing based on the number of users, projects, or storage capacity. Some vendors offer customized enterprise solutions with tailored pricing. Factors influencing cost include the software’s features and functionalities, the level of support provided, integration capabilities with existing systems, and the scale of the agency’s operations. Generally, expect to pay anywhere from a few hundred dollars per month for basic plans to several thousand for comprehensive enterprise solutions. It’s crucial to carefully evaluate the features and pricing of different options to find the best fit for your agency’s budget and needs. Free trials or demos can help assess the software’s suitability before committing to a purchase.
